- The distance between Naxos, Greece and Maraba, Brazil is approximately 9,013 km or 5,601 mi.
- To reach Naxos in this distance one would set out from Maraba bearing 51.1° or NE and follow the great circles arc to approach Naxos bearing 76.3° or ENE .
- Naxos has a Mediterranean hot climate (Csa) whereas Maraba has a tropical monsoonal climate (Am).
- The average annual temperature is 8 °C (14.4°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 10.1 °C (18.2°F) more in Naxos.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to extremely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1705.7 mm (67.2 in) less which is equivalent to 1705.7 l/m² (41.86 US gal/ft²) or 17,057,000 l/ha (1,823,507 US gal/ac) less. About 1/6 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 21.1° lower in Naxos than in Maraba.
- Relative humidity levels are 11.5% lower.
- The mean dew point temperature is 10.2°C (18.4°F) lower.
